Monument of Sanitary Heroes in Bucharest. Creation of the italian sculptor Raffaello Romanelli, located in the Eroilor Square, near the National Opera. Erected in 1932, it is dedicated to the memory of the medics, corpsmen and voluntary sisters saving lives in the First World War. The base is made of marbles. It is assumed that the women represented is Queen Mary of Romania.
